What Causes Misted Glass?
Misted glass happens mostly due to seal failure in Expert Double Glazing Repair-glazed windows. The seals, typically made from rubber or silicone, are developed to keep moisture and air from going into the area in between the glass panes. When these seals degrade or are harmed, moisture discovers its way inside, leading to condensation. Aspects contributing to Misted Up Window Repair glass include:
Age of the Windows: Older windows are more vulnerable to seal failure.Temperature Fluctuations: Rapid modifications in temperature level can worry window products.Poor Installation: Incorrect setup techniques can cause early failure of seals.Environmental Conditions: High humidity environments can accelerate seal destruction.
Understanding these causes can assist house owners take preventive procedures to preserve their windows.
The Replacement Process
The procedure of changing misted glass normally involves numerous steps. Although the specific procedure may vary depending upon different aspects, typical practices consist of:

Assessment: A professional evaluates the condition of the window to identify if replacement is required and assess general damage.

Removal: The professional eliminates the existing window system from the frame, taking care to decrease damage to surrounding structures.

Measurement and Ordering: Accurate measurements are required to ensure that the brand-new glass fits properly. Custom-made glass panels are frequently bought from producers.

Installation of New Glass: The brand-new glass system is installed, guaranteeing that seals are effectively aligned and fitted to prevent future misting.

Final Inspection: A comprehensive evaluation is performed to ensure whatever is sealed properly and operating as it should.

The cost of replacing misted glass can vary significantly based on numerous elements, including:
Type of Glass: Specialty or custom glass will usually cost more.Size of the Window: Larger windows tend to be more expensive to replace.Labor Costs: Professional installation fees will vary based on place and company track record.Estimated Costs
Below is a table laying out estimated expenses for misted glass replacement based upon window types:
Window Condensation Repair TypeAverage Cost (GBP)Standard Double Glazing Repairs Glazed₤ 200 - ₤ 500Triple Glazed₤ 300 - ₤ 700Specialized Glass₤ 400 - ₤ 1,200Bay or Bow Windows₤ 500 - ₤ 1,500
Please note that these rates are approximate and can vary based on geographic area, specific contractors, and additional materials needed.

A1: While some DIY solutions are readily available, such as utilizing a moisture eliminator, professional replacement is normally advised for ideal outcomes and durability.
Q2: How long does the replacement process take?
A2: The replacement procedure can take anywhere from one to 4 hours, depending on the complexity of the task and the variety of windows included.
Q3: Are there any long-term solutions to avoid misted glass?
A3: Regular inspections and timely replacement of any damaged seals can assist prevent misted glass. Having quality windows set up by credible specialists likewise reduces the risk of future problems.
Q4: What is the lifespan of double-glazed windows?
A4: Double-glazed windows can last anywhere from 10 to 30 years, depending on their quality, installation, and maintenance.
